Support Your NACAA Scholarship Fund !!!

 The Scholarship Program provides professional improvement opportunities for members. The funding is provided by the NACAA Educational Foundation.


Scholarships can be awarded to an individual or groups. In order to be eligible for up to $1,000, you must have contributed at least $40 to the fund. Members need to be vested at $100 to be eligible for up to $2,000 during their Extension career. No monetary award can be over $1,000 in any one year. The online application submission deadline is June 1 annually. The award recipients are selected on the 1st day of AM/PIC. This year applications were reviewed/awarded on July 10.

NOYF Application Deadline Extended to Oct. 5, 2020

 NACAA Members,

The National Outstanding Farmers of America have extended their deadline for applications for the National Outstanding Young Farmers program until October 5, 2020. This program is an incredible opportunity for farmers under 40 years of age and their Extension Agents. Please nominate your eligible young farmers.

The following criteria must be met during the nomination process:

  • All nominees must be submitted on the official Outstanding Young Farmers Nomination Form, found on the Outstanding Farmers of America website - www.outstandingfarmers.com  
  • Be postmarked before October 5, 2020
  • Nomination forms should be completed on the form downloaded from the website, not handwritten .

  To qualify:

  • Nominees must be between the ages of 21 and 40, not becoming 41 prior to January 1 before the NOYF Awards Congress.
  • Nominees must be actual farm operators, deriving a minimum of two-thirds of their income from farming.
  • Nominee must email or mail the completed NOYF nomination form.
  • The submission addresses as well as additional information about the National Outstanding Young Farmers Awards Congress and program can be obtained by visiting www.outstandingfarmers.com

  All NOYF Awards Program participants are judged on personal contributions in the following categories:

  • Progress in agricultural career (50%)
  • Extent of soil and water conservation practices (25%)
  • Contributions to the well-being of their community, state, and nation (25%)

Journal of NACAA, Call for Papers

Dear NACAA Member,

 

September 15t  is the fall article submission deadline for publication in the December 1st   issue of the Journal of the NACAA.  Submission guidelines can be found at   https://www.nacaa.com/journal/instructions.php

 

This is an opportunity for NACAA members to publish some of the great work you all are doing.  The Journal of NACAA considers diverse topics that include current research, case studies, examples of outstanding Extension programming, and innovative ideas.  Non-NACAA members can be authors as long as a co-author is a member.  However, we highly encourage non-member authors to join NACAA.

 

Publishing in the Journal of NACAA is a great way to build your resume/CV and document your successes as you work toward attaining promotion or tenure in your institution.
